-
Notifications
You must be signed in to change notification settings - Fork 11
Telepickups
TEPI to skrót od teleporting pickups.
Jest to nazwa dla wdrożonego na FullServerze mechanizmu pickupów przenoszących graczy.
- punktu wejściowego, w którym umieszczany jest pickup (standardowo strzałka)
- opisu, opcjonalnie pokazywanego nad pickupem
- punktu wyjściowego, w który przenoszony jest gracz po wejściu w telepickup
Limit telepickupów jest zmienny i obecnie wynosi 400 elementów. Można go w dowolnej chwili podnieść, lecz wymaga to rekompilacji gamemodu i ogólnie wpływa negatywnie na prędkość jego działania. Warto dbać o to, aby telepickupów było jak najmniej.
- punkt wyjściowy ma określony interior oraz vw - domyślnie 0,0.
- punkt wejściowy ma określony interior oraz vw, oba te pola mogą przyjąć wartość -1 i wtedy znajdują się w każdym interiorze i/lub wirtualnym świecie.
- telepickup może posiadać ograniczeine do danego gangu - członkowie innych gangów, lub członkowie bez gangu nie bedą mogli z niego skorzystać
- telepickup może posiadać ograniczenie rangi - np. od moderatora wzwyż, od admina wzwyż itd.
Edycja telepickupów może odbywać się w bazie danych, do której mają dostęp rconi. Oprócz tego istnieje kilka komend usprawniających ich edycję i umożliwiających dokonanie części operacji na nich. Są to:
(komendy są dostępne tylko dla rconów oraz maperów)
/tepireload - przeładowuje wszystkie telepickupy (a także inne elementy: repi, mipi, tecp, itd.).
/addtepi - dodaje w miejscu, w którym stoi gracz telepickup o podanym opisie.
/tepitu - ustawia punkt wyjściowy dodanego wcześniej telepickupu. Telepickupy muszą być przeładowane po dodaniu nowego
/rmtepi - usuwa dany telepickup.
-
Idziecie w miejscie gdzie ma być telepickup, wpisujecie /addtepi
-
Na ekranie pojawia sie ID dodanego tepi, zapamiętujecie je i wpisujecie /tepireload.
-
Idziecie w miejsce gdzie ma być punkt wyjściowy, wpisujecie /tepitu .
4./tepireload i gotowe.
Używając komendy /tepitu lub /rmtepi zwracajcie szczególną uwagę na podawanie prawidlowych id. Jeśli podacie ID innego pickupu, to ten inny zostanie zmieniony! Jeśli zaistnieje taka sytuacja, to powiadomcie o niej RCONa, aby mógł to szybko naprawić.
Opis telepickupu musi być taki, aby RCON mógł go łatwo rozróżnić w bazie danych. Zamiast więc np. 'wejście' podawajcie 'budynek gangu'.
Aby poznać ID telepickupu, należy wpisać komendę /tepireload cokolwiek - załadują się one wtedy wraz z identyfikatorami dołączonymi do opisu.
Tylko rcon może włączyć pokazywanie się napisu nad pickupem, zmienić kolor napisu bądź symbol telepickupu, ograniczyć dostęp do danego gangu lub rangi. Jeśli chcecie przekazać mu taką prosbę, spiszcie wszystkie ID telepickupów których ma dotyczyć ta zmiana.
Proszę, pamietajcie aby nie szaleć z ładowaniem telepickupów na serwer, używajcie tego w granicach rozsądku.